LFC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2018 in Review
112 of the 4,364 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in China Life Insurance Company Ltd. (LFC) for Q1 2018, worth a combined $214M — down 19% from $264M a quarter earlier.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 22 funds opened new LFC positions and 14 closed out — a net gain of 8 holders — while 35 added to existing stakes and 39 trimmed.
The largest buyer was Segantii Capital Management, opening a new position worth an estimated $4.24M. The largest seller was Moore Capital Management, exiting entirely with an estimated $32.8M sold.
